ATSAM4S16CA-AN Description
The ATSAM4S16CA-AN is a microcontroller unit (MCU) from Microchip Technology's SAM4S series. It is based on a 32-bit ARM Cortex-M4 processor and is designed for a wide range of embedded applications.
